If \(U=\{1,2,3,4,5,6,7,8,9,10\}\) and \(A=\{x:x\in U,\ x\ge 7\}\), what is \(A'\)?
Answer and explanation
Correct answer: \(\{1,2,3,4,5,6\}\)
The condition \(x\ge 7\) includes 7 and every larger element of the universal set. Thus, \(A=\{7,8,9,10\}\). The complement contains the elements of \(U\) that are not in \(A\), namely \(\{1,2,3,4,5,6\}\). Since the inequality includes equality, 7 belongs to \(A\), not to \(A'\).
